Understanding B2B Online Trading

B2B online trading involves transactions between businesses through digital platforms. Unlike B2C (business-to-consumer) models, B2B trading focuses on larger order volumes, longer sales cycles, and more complex logistics. Successful B2B trading requires a deep understanding of market dynamics, cultural nuances, and technological infrastructures.

Key Components of B2B Trading

  • Digital Platforms: Robust eCommerce platforms are the backbone of B2B trading, enabling efficient order management, inventory control, and customer relationship management.
  • Fulfillment Solutions: Effective fulfillment strategies ensure timely delivery and reliable service, which are critical for maintaining business relationships.
  • Regulatory Compliance: Navigating international trade regulations, such as ICP licensing and PIPL compliance, is essential for smooth market entry and operations.

Business-to-business Trade Models

Several trade models underpin B2B online trading, each catering to different business needs and market conditions. Understanding these models can help businesses choose the right strategy for their goals.

1. Supplier-Oriented Model

In this model, suppliers list their products on a digital platform, connecting directly with potential buyers. It emphasizes ease of access and broad product visibility.

2. Buyer-Oriented Model

Here, buyers create profiles and list their requirements, allowing suppliers to propose tailored solutions. This model fosters customized interactions and long-term partnerships.

3. Intermediary Model

Intermediaries facilitate transactions by providing a platform where multiple buyers and sellers can interact. They often offer additional services such as payment processing and dispute resolution.

4. Hybrid Model

Combining elements of the above models, the hybrid approach offers flexibility and caters to diverse business needs, often incorporating advanced features like AI-driven analytics and personalized recommendations.

Best Practices for B2B Online Trading

Implementing best practices can significantly enhance the effectiveness of your B2B online trading strategy.

1. Leverage Data-Driven Insights

Utilize analytics to understand buyer behavior, track performance metrics, and make informed decisions. Tools like Ripple Marketing’s customizable Ripple Dashboard offer real-time tracking of KPIs and ROI.

2. Ensure Cultural Resonance

Localization is key to successful B2B trading. Tailor your messaging and visuals to align with the cultural preferences of your target market, ensuring authentic engagement.

3. Optimize User Experience

A seamless and intuitive user experience on your digital platform can accelerate transactions and improve customer satisfaction. Prioritize mobile responsiveness and easy navigation.

4. Foster Strong Relationships

Building and maintaining strong relationships with your business partners can lead to long-term collaborations and repeat business. Focus on transparent communication and reliable service delivery.
